I'm honestly really happy with how the system works. -------------------------------------------------------------------------- W12MODS I think I am going to play wanted monty mole or boulderdash first. -------------------------------------------------------------------------- Scorf Back in 85 I was awestruck by Impossible Mission, eventually I memorised one of the room set ups and could complete the game without being killed or having to use the phone. Think it took about 17 mins to do it. One thing I've noticed so far is that whenever I have loaded the game you get the same room plan and configuration. Not tried pressing restore to see if that gives a new config as It did back in the day. For anyone encountering Paradroid - they are in for a treat. Its well worth tracking down the diary of a game feature that was in Zzap! in 1985. Andrew Braybrook treats his audience as adults and its a real insight into the writing of a game - he would repeat this in 87 with Morbius. I remember Zzap! giving Paradroid 100% for presentation, and its so well deserved. You are never waiting for some fancy effect or screen before you can get into the game - you just press fire. So many games should have learned from this. -------------------------------------------------------------------------- PantherUK [7]Scorf Yep I can confirm Restore works in Impossible Mission, its a bug in the disk version of the game that effectively kills the randomiser, you had to press Restore back in the day with the disk version... -------------------------------------------------------------------------- Killamarshian I agree. I'm still absolutely loving my one. -------------------------------------------------------------------------- Braindome Wizball, Parallax, Ghostbusters, Rambo first blood part II, and Sanxion are all high on my list for trying soon. -------------------------------------------------------------------------- Scorf The infocom (Zork, Hitch Hikers etc) were never released on tape in the UK as far as I remember. I only ever had one - Starcross I think, and it annoyed me intensely that every time you entered a command, the program accessed the disk. Remember this is the 1541 we are talking about - the slowest, most god-awful disk drive in the world... Had to smile though when watching Young Sheldon last week as he was pondering cutting notches into the other side of the 5.25 inch floppy, thus allowing the other side to be used. I did that with all of mine! Getting back to Paradroid, its a shame that the version on the mini is the original release. Andrew Braybrook was almost unique in that when his games were re-released on compilations, he usually revisited the code and improved it. Hence the Paradroid that came with Uridium as a double pack is noticeably faster to play. I think theres also a version called Heavy Metal Paradroid with altered graphics which runs every faster. I think I inwardly wept when I played Paradroid 90 (or whatever it was called) on the Amiga and was appalled that it wasn't a 360 degree scroller. -------------------------------------------------------------------------- Darbyram [3]johnnyhotrocks i forgot about elite... :-) -------------------------------------------------------------------------- Parcival [4]@trolliewallied LCP by Activision! Thanks again. -------------------------------------------------------------------------- stuarty38 [3]Braindome how did u get Bruce Lee to work I can load the game but he doesn't move cheers -------------------------------------------------------------------------- Braindome [4]stuarty38 I used a PS4 controller to select BASIC before loading the game. The PS4 controller doesn't work reliably with the C64 mini, but you only need it to launch BASIC. You can unplug it if/when it starts causing problems. Using this controller causes the C64 joystick to be mapping to the other C64 joystick port, thus allowing it to be used for games like Bruce Lee. It's a bit of a pain, but hopefully a future firmware update will make this workaround unnecessary. Another other game controller that's recognised by the system can be used as an alternative. Another option I've heard of is to hack the game (or find an already hacked version) so it uses the other joystick port by default. -------------------------------------------------------------------------- RetroBiker [5]stuarty38 how did u get Bruce Lee to work I can load the game but he doesn't move cheers The point here is that when you just have one controller, it is configured as port 2 so having another controller connected when you go into BASIC will mean you have one on port 1 which most (many?) games will expect.
